Re: Help ID this cool old boat! Someone should save it!

That's a Chrysler shallow Vee. It has quite a following among the Chrysler Crew--Chrysler outboard and boat enthusiasts. Re: Help ID this cool old boat! Someone should save it!

It is up around 17-18 feet long and rated for somewhere around 105-120. The 105 was Chrysler's basic "big" engine and was found on a lot of hulls.

I am not certain, but I believe the hull was called "Charger" thus the Dodge Charger gas cap. But Chrysler marine division used the name Charger on a lot of engines and boats. They also had a Valiant and a couple of other names borrowed from the auto division. However, most Chrysler fans know this hull as: shallow vee.
